We’re looking for an Accounts Manager to join the team at Langton Homes based in Uppingham, Rutland.
This is a varied role within a growing housebuilding business, combining responsibility for the company’s day-to-day accounts with a range of wider administrative and operational responsibilities.
You’ll play an important part in keeping the business running smoothly, working closely with the directors, site teams, suppliers and external consultants.
The role will include responsibility for:
- Supplier invoices, payments and month-end payment runs
- Xero, including bank reconciliations, journals and maintaining accurate financial records
- Monthly VAT and CIS returns
- Payroll and monthly cashflow management
- Cashflow projections and financial administration
- Supplier queries and general account management
- Building Control and warranty applications, inspections and documentation
- Coordinating utility and service connections across our developments
- General office administration and liaising with external suppliers and service providers

We’re looking for someone who is organised, proactive and detail-focused, with good financial knowledge and the ability to manage their own workload. Experience with Xero would be an advantage, as would experience within construction or property business, but most importantly we’re looking for someone who is happy working across a varied role.
